Over late 2017/early 2018 I was painting up a reasonably-sized Ming Chinese army for us with FoGAm/FoGR and Art de la Guerre.  However, it was lacking two things - firearms troops and artillery.  I didn't like the handgunners from Old Glory 15s (they were very early types) so I eventually ordered some of the Grumpy Miniature ones from Eureka, which I collected at Salute in April. I also ordered some of their rocket launcher troops, which will serve as light artillery and regimental gun markers.

After finishing the SYW Russians I wanted something quick to submit as an extra this week and settled on these arquebusiers. These give me two units for FoGAM/FoGR or six units for ADLG.










The officers, trumpeters and spear/halberd troops are Old Glory 15s and slightly bigger than the chubby-cheeked Grumpy ones.
